PaySign is a company that helps businesses manage payments and subscriptions easily. They offer services like digital wallets and prepaid cards, making it simple for people to receive money or pay for things online. If you see a charge from PaySign, it's likely linked to a subscription or bill you've signed up for, which they help process securely and efficiently.

How to Cancel PaySign: Step by Step
If you purchased through paysign.com:
Go to paysign.com and log in to your account.
Navigate to the Account section from the dashboard.
Select Subscriptions or Bills from the menu.
Locate the subscription you want to cancel.
Click on Manage next to the subscription.
Select Cancel Subscription.
Follow the prompts to confirm the cancellation.
If you purchased through Google Play:
Open the Google Play Store app on your device.
Tap on the Menu icon (three horizontal lines) in the top-left corner.
Select Subscriptions.
Find the PaySign subscription and tap on it.
Tap Cancel Subscription.
Follow the prompts to confirm the cancellation.
If you purchased through Apple:
Open the Settings app on your iPhone or iPad.
Tap on your Name at the top of the screen.
Select Subscriptions.
Find the PaySign subscription and tap on it.
Tap Cancel Subscription.
Confirm the cancellation by following the prompts.
If you purchased through a prepaid card:
Visit paysign.com and log in to your account.
Go to the Account section.
Select Billing.
Find the subscription associated with your prepaid card.
Click on Manage and then select Cancel Subscription.
Confirm the cancellation by following the prompts.
If you purchased through customer service:
Call the PaySign customer service number at 1-888-495-6510.
Provide your account details to the representative.
Request to cancel your subscription.
Follow any additional instructions given by the representative to confirm the cancellation.

Before cancelling your PaySign subscription, consider that you will lose access to features such as prepaid card functionality, account management tools, and transaction history. Additionally, any unspent balance on your card may be forfeited upon cancellation, so ensure to use or transfer funds if possible. Keep in mind that any promotional offers or loyalty rewards linked to your account will also be lost. Finally, check the cancellation policy for any potential fees or conditions that might apply.
